status: closed starter for @mina-lewis
location: Castle of the Isle
time: afternoon
Before she got to Port Vale, Aster never worried about the weather and how that affected how she dressed and whether she needed an umbrella, that day. She made the mistake of walking around without even so much as a raincoat when it had been pouring out, and one of the locals had been kind enough to usher her under their umbrella. She found it so odd that humans chose to bathe twice a day, naked under a showerhead, but were terrified of getting wet with their clothes on under the rain. Then again, living in the sea meant that she was surrounded by water constantly. It made her wonder if she was constantly submerged in water, was she ever wet?
The semantics of it all seemed to occupy her thoughts as she wandered around town without a destination in mind. She blinked through the light shower, making sure to stand within the confounds of her umbrella, this time. The ruins of the castle seemed almost peaceful in this type of weather. She had to resist the urge to run in the rain and bask in the cool breeze, like she saw in those old Nicholas Sparks movies. Something as trivial as this rain made her miss her own sea.
She was a bit lost in her thoughts that she almost didn’t notice the woman trying her best to shelter herself from the rain by a small crevice with what was left of a little roof. “Got caught in the rain?” She asked. “Were you headed somewhere in particular? I can share my umbrella.”
